Male urethral syringe
Date
1870-1880
Description
Large glass urethral syringe narrowing to a bulb point at the lower end, with barrel and plunger, cotton piston and cork stopper at upper end. Used for urethral obstruction.
This item was originally donated to the Medical Society of Victoria (which later became part of the Victorian Branch of the Australian Medical Association). The A.M.A. moved its historical collection of documents and artifacts to the University of Melbourne's Medical History Museum in 1994 as a long term loan, then ownership was offically transferred to the Museum in 2011.
